There are several different types of auto insurance, and many policies include one or more of these coverage types.
- Liability insurance — This is the most basic type of car insurance and is often required by last. This type of auto insurance covers injuries and property damage that you cause to others in an accident.
- Collision coverage — Collision coverage pays for the repairs or replacement of your own car in the event of an accident, regardless of who is at fault. This is especially valuable for newer or more expensive vehicles.
- Comprehensive coverage — Comprehensive coverage protects your car from non-collision incidents, such as theft, vandalism, natural disasters, or hitting an animal. This provides coverage for any damages that are not the result of a collision.
- Uninsured/underinsured motorist coverage — This coverage protects you if you’re involved in an accident with a driver who either has no insurance or insufficient insurance to cover your damages. It can include both bodily injury and property damage coverage.
